Tip To find out which version of Totem you re using GStreamer or Xine click Help About in Totem.

You will note, of course, that a single subquery can easily fall across several of these categories there is nothing stopping a correlated subquery from being an aggregate, returning at most one row for a nonexistence test. (But at least, when I see one like that, I know that I may have to think about it very carefully if it s not doing what I expect.) In this volume, I m going to stick to simple subqueries, play about a little bit with in/exists, not in/not exists, and say a little bit about unnesting, semi-joins, and anti-joins. So let s go back to script filter_cost_01.sql, which started this chapter, and modify it to allow 9i to do what it wants with our very first test case. What does the execution plan look like See script unnest_cost_01.sql in the online code suite. Execution Plan ( with no hints - an unnest occurs) ---------------------------------------------------------0 SELECT STATEMENT Optimizer=ALL_ROWS (Cost=100 Card=1000 Bytes=98000) 1 0 HASH JOIN (Cost=100 Card=1000 Bytes=98000) 2 1 VIEW OF 'VW_SQ_1' (Cost=64 Card=6 Bytes=156) 3 2 SORT (GROUP BY) (Cost=64 Card=6 Bytes=48) 4 3 TABLE ACCESS (FULL) OF 'EMP' (Cost=35 Card=20000 Bytes=160000) 5 1 TABLE ACCESS (FULL) OF 'EMP' (Cost=35 Card=20000 Bytes=1440000) Execution Plan ( when we forced a FILTER) ---------------------------------------------------------0 SELECT STATEMENT Optimizer=ALL_ROWS (Cost=35035 Card=1000 Bytes=72000) 1 0 FILTER 2 1 TABLE ACCESS (FULL) OF 'EMP' (Cost=35 Card=1000 Bytes=72000) 3 1 SORT (AGGREGATE) 4 3 TABLE ACCESS (FULL) OF 'EMP' (Cost=35 Card=3333 Bytes=26664)
Using the Mouse
private static int portletCounter = 0; private int renderCounter = 0; private int actionCounter = 0; }
CHAPTER 13: File Services
Active patterns can also be partial. You can recognize a partial pattern by a name such as (|MulThree|_|) and by the fact that it returns a value of type 'T option for some 'T. For example: let (|MulThree|_|) inp = if inp % 3 = 0 then Some(inp/3) else None let (|MulSeven|_|) inp = if inp % 7 = 0 then Some(inp/7) else None Finally, active patterns can also be parameterized. You can recognize a parameterized active pattern by the fact that it takes several arguments. For example: let (|MulN|_|) n inp = if inp % n = 0 then Some(inp/n) else None The F# quotation API Microsoft.FSharp.Quotations uses both parameterized and partial patterns extensively.
Server context established:false Performing handshake Exchanging tokens Exchanging tokens Handshake completed Server context established:true OK
SQL Server is configured using SQL Server Configuration Manager. From here, you can control the services, the native client, and the network configuration. On the network configuration screen (see Figure 6-12), you should make sure that the TCP service is enabled and running.
Note Using large, volatile discriminated unions freely in APIs encourages people to use pattern-matching
Table 5-3. Possible Values of ValidationType
Specifying Links to Other Members
This expression approximates the season based on the current date. If the month is December, January, or February, the expression evaluates to 0. Similarly March, April, and May evaluate to 1. You will now create four branches; one for each season.
Text Size
public void Handle_Click(Object obj, RoutedEventArgs e) { }
Try It Out: Dropping a Database in SQL Server Management Studio
We covered relationships in 3, but we ve not created any. Now we will. The first relationship that we create will be between the customer and customer transactions tables. This will be
